In spring 2005, as sand was scoured away by late winter winds, a cache of old 45 gallon diesel fuel drums appeared in the East Light area on Sable Island. The drums could have been buried there since the early 1970s. After the light was automated, and the house was no longer used by a light keeper, researchers with both Fisheries & Oceans Canada, and Dalhousie University, occupied the house as a seasonal field camp. The fuel would have been used for heating and for tractor operation. |
